MP1653FGTF-Z MPS synchronous buck converter
The MP1653FGTF-Z is a high-efficiency synchronous step-down converter from Monolithic Power Systems (MPS), integrating low RDS(ON) power MOSFETs in a compact 6-pin SOT563 (1.6mm×1.6mm) package for space-constrained power supply designs. It operates over a wide 4.5V to 16V input voltage range, delivers up to 3A continuous output current, and supports an adjustable output voltage from 0.6V to 8V. Featuring constant-on-time (COT) control, it provides fast transient response, simple loop compensation, and tight output regulation with ±1% feedback accuracy at room temperature. The device includes comprehensive protection features such as short-circuit protection (SCP), over-current protection (OCP), thermal shutdown, and input over-voltage protection (OVP), ensuring safe and reliable operation in various fault conditions.
Step-down converter Key Features and Applications
This buck converter achieves high efficiency up to 95% thanks to its 32mΩ/58mΩ low on-resistance internal MOSFETs and synchronous rectification, minimizing power dissipation and extending battery life in portable systems. It switches at a fixed 1.1MHz frequency, balancing efficiency and external component size while reducing EMI. The device offers pre-bias startup, enabling (EN) pin for power sequencing, and hiccup-mode OCP for robust current limiting. With a low 180μA quiescent current and an industrial temperature range of -40°C to 125°C, it is optimized for both consumer and industrial applications requiring high efficiency and compact size.
It is widely used in consumer electronics such as set-top boxes, LCD monitors, and home theater systems, providing efficient point-of-load regulation. It serves portable devices like tablets, notebooks, and power banks, where its small package and high efficiency are critical for battery-powered operation. Additionally, it is applied in industrial control systems, automotive infotainment, and ADAS, delivering reliable step-down conversion for 5V, 3.3V, and 1.8V power rails in compact, high-density designs.
